Spiritual Growth:

Songs of Ascent:  There are 15 Psalms labeled as songs of ascent.  It is thought that Israelites would sing them as they journeyed to Jerusalem for religious holidays and feasts.  We are adopting them as we think we are on a journey together. We will take at least one a week throughout our semester to meditate, pray over and worship.  We’ll start at the beginning.  120.
